Cooking Tips and Notes

Perfecting Your Sear

Searing the steak before placing it in the crockpot is a crucial step that adds depth to the flavor. Make sure your skillet is hot enough so that the steak develops a beautiful brown crust. This caramelization not only enhances the taste but also locks in the juices, ensuring a moist and tender outcome.

Timing is Everything

The cooking time for the Keto Steak In Crockpot can vary based on your slow cooker model. If you’re cooking on low, aim for 8 hours for the best texture. If you’re short on time, the high setting at 4 hours will still yield a delicious result, just keep an eye on it to prevent overcooking.

Customize Your Seasoning

Feel free to experiment with the seasonings to suit your palate. Adding a pinch of red pepper flakes can introduce a pleasant heat, while a splash of balsamic vinegar can provide a sweet tang. The beauty of this recipe is its versatility, making it easy to adapt to your taste preferences.

Storing Leftovers

If you have any leftovers, store them in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to three days. Reheating the steak in the crockpot with a bit of beef broth can help retain moisture, making it just as enjoyable the second time around. This dish is ideal for meal prep, ensuring you have a satisfying meal ready to go throughout the week.

FAQ based on “People Also Ask” section

What is the best cut of beef for the Keto Steak In Crockpot?

For the Keto Steak In Crockpot, cuts like chuck roast, brisket, or flank steak work beautifully. These cuts are well-marbled and become tender and flavorful when cooked slowly, making them ideal for this recipe.

Can I make this dish ahead of time?

Absolutely! You can prepare the Keto Steak In Crockpot ahead of time. Simply season the steak and place it in the crockpot with the broth, then refrigerate it until you’re ready to cook. This makes it a perfect option for meal prepping during a busy week.

How do I store leftovers?

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to three days. To reheat, simply warm the steak in the crockpot with a splash of beef broth to keep it moist and tender.

Can I freeze the Keto Steak In Crockpot?

Yes, this dish freezes well! After cooking, let the steak cool completely, then store it in a freezer-safe container. It can be frozen for up to three months. Just thaw it in the refrigerator before reheating.

Keto Steak In Crockpot


5 Stars 4 Stars 3 Stars 2 Stars 1 Star

No reviews

  • Author: olivia RECIPES
  • Total Time: 4 hours 15 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Diet: Keto

Description

This Keto Steak In Crockpot recipe is a delicious and easy-to-make dish that is perfect for low-carb diets.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 pounds beef steak
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 cup beef broth
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il

Instructions

  1. Season the steak with gar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, salt, and pepper.
  2.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at and sear the steak for 3-4 minutes on each side.
  3. Place the steak in the crockpot and pour in the beef broth.
  4. Cook on low for 8 hours or high for 4 hours.
  5. Remove the steak from the crockpot and let rest before slicing.

Notes

  • For additional flavor, you can add herbs like rosemary or thyme.
  • Serve with steamed vegetables for a complete meal.
  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 4 hours
  • Category: Dinner
  • Method: Slow Cooker
  • Cuisine: American

Nutrition

  • Serving Size: 1 serving
  • Calories: 400
  • Sugar: 0g
  • Sodium: 700mg
  • Fat: 30g
  • Saturated Fat: 12g
  • Unsaturated Fat: 15g
  • Trans Fat: 0g
  • Carbohydrates: 2g
  • Fiber: 0g
  • Protein: 36g
  • Cholesterol: 90mg
